VGCC Franklin Campus offers Class for Bookkeepers, Administrative Professionals

Tuesday, September 9, 2008 7:00 pm EDT

Description: An upcoming course at Vance-Granville Community College’s Franklin County Campus is designed for employees who want to brush up on organizational and bookkeeping skills while improving their secretarial and receptionist skills. “Bookkeeping/Administrative Assistant Training” will be held on Tuesdays, Sept. 9 through Nov. 25, from 6 p.m. until 9 p.m. on the Franklin campus, located on N.C. 56 about one mile west of Louisburg.

Students will learn about accounting principles, payroll records, inventory systems, telephone skills/professionalism, time management, business communication and problem solving. Classes will include guest speakers, classroom projects and hands-on activities. Participants who successfully complete the course will receive 3.6 CEU's and a Certificate of Completion for 36 classroom membership hours.

The cost of the class will be $55 plus the cost of a textbook.

The class is limited in size. For more information and to reserve a seat, call the Franklin County Campus at (919) 496-1567.
